Step-by-step explanation:
Look at the bottom right angle, a straight line is 180 degrees, the line separating going on the line is at a 90 degree angle as there's a square that represents a right angle for the outer angle, the inner angle is also 90 as 90+90=180. A triangle is 180 degrees, all the equations plus 90 equals 180 so:
8x + 1 + 5x - 2 + 90 = 180
add like terms
13x + 89 = 180
subtract 89 from both sides
13x = 91
divide by 13
x = 7
Replace the equation the x in 5x - 2 to find angle 1, a straight line is 180 degrees so:
5x - 2 + ∠1 = 180
5(7) - 2 + ∠1 = 180
35 - 2 + ∠1 = 180
33 + ∠1 = 180
subtract 33 from both sides
∠1 = 147
